Attempted Lines on Sargents/Green Butte Ridge

Attempted Lines on Sargents/Green Butte Ridge

January 10, 2010 - These are the ways I took on my failed January 10th attempt at Sargents Ridge and my successful February 15th attempt at Green Butte Ridge. Each number indicates where we were turned back by the route not "going". #5 is actually the way to go, but it didn't look too promising until I eliminated the remaining options! A couple of the dead ends on the February climb were more from my partner being too eager to climb upwards, even though I kept telling him to stay lower.
